🔍 Diagnóstico de eCatólico Puzzles

1. Verificación del Entorno PHP

Versión de PHP: 8.2.30 ✓ OK

Extensiones PHP:

ExtensiónEstado
pdo✓ Instalada
pdo_mysql✓ Instalada
json✓ Instalada
mbstring✓ Instalada
session✓ Instalada

2. Verificación de Archivos

ArchivoExistePermiso
includes/config.php✓ Existe✓ Legible
includes/Database.php✓ Existe✓ Legible
includes/Security.php✓ Existe✓ Legible
includes/functions.php✓ Existe✓ Legible
includes/Puzzle.php✓ Existe✓ Legible
index.php✓ Existe✓ Legible
.htaccess✓ Existe✓ Legible

3. Verificación de Configuración

Constantes Definidas:

ConstanteValorEstado
DB_HOSTlocalhost✓ OK
DB_NAMEmds2wa5nsxdmtgmp_album5✓ OK
DB_USERmds2wa5nsxdmtgmp_album5✓ OK
DB_PASS**********************✓ OK
SITE_NAMEActividades eCatólico✓ OK
SITE_URLhttps://actividades.ecatolico.com✓ OK
DEFAULT_LANGes✓ OK

4. Verificación de Base de Datos

✓ Conexión a base de datos exitosa

Tablas encontradas (2):

Actividades en BD: 17

Usuarios en BD: 1

5. Verificación de Permisos

DirectorioExisteLecturaEscritura
.
includes
modules
assets
assets/css
assets/js
sql

6. Verificación de .htaccess

✓ Archivo .htaccess existe

Contenido actual:

RewriteEngine On
<FilesMatch "\.(json|log|sql)$">
    Require all denied
</FilesMatch>
<IfModule mod_headers.c>
    Header set X-Content-Type-Options "nosniff"
    Header set X-Frame-Options "SAMEORIGIN"
    Header set X-XSS-Protection "1; mode=block"
</IfModule>
Options -Indexes
AddDefaultCharset UTF-8

✓ mod_rewrite habilitado

7. Información del Servidor

VariableValor
ServidorLiteSpeed
Document Root/home/mds2wa5nsxdmtgmp/public_html/actividades
Script Filename/home/mds2wa5nsxdmtgmp/public_html/actividades/diagnostico.php
PHP SAPIlitespeed
OSLinux

8. Logs de Error de PHP

Archivo de log: /home/mds2wa5nsxdmtgmp/public_html/actividades/logs/error.log

Últimos 20 errores:

  thrown in /home/mds2wa5nsxdmtgmp/public_html/actividades/galeria.php on line 15
[04-Jul-2026 21:47:13 America/Mexico_City] PHP Warning:  session_start(): Session cannot be started after headers have already been sent in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php on line 89
[04-Jul-2026 21:47:13 America/Mexico_City] PHP Fatal error:  Uncaught Error: Call to undefined method Security::validate() in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php:133
Stack trace:
#0 {main}
  thrown in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php on line 133
[04-Jul-2026 23:45:53 America/Mexico_City] PHP Warning:  session_start(): Session cannot be started after headers have already been sent in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php on line 89
[04-Jul-2026 23:45:53 America/Mexico_City] PHP Fatal error:  Uncaught Error: Call to undefined method Security::validate() in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php:133
Stack trace:
#0 {main}
  thrown in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php on line 133
[04-Jul-2026 23:46:06 America/Mexico_City] PHP Warning:  session_start(): Session cannot be started after headers have already been sent in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php on line 89
[04-Jul-2026 23:46:06 America/Mexico_City] PHP Fatal error:  Uncaught Error: Call to undefined method Security::validate() in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php:133
Stack trace:
#0 {main}
  thrown in /home/mds2wa5nsxdmtgmp/public_html/actividades/debug.php on line 133
[04-Jul-2026 23:47:11 America/Mexico_City] PHP Fatal error:  Uncaught Error: Call to undefined method Security::validate() in /home/mds2wa5nsxdmtgmp/public_html/actividades/galeria.php:15
Stack trace:
#0 {main}
  thrown in /home/mds2wa5nsxdmtgmp/public_html/actividades/galeria.php on line 15

9. Test de Includes

Probando: includes/Database.php

✓ Include exitoso (sin errores)

Probando: includes/Security.php

✓ Include exitoso (sin errores)

Probando: includes/functions.php

✓ Include exitoso (sin errores)

10. Recomendaciones

✓ No se encontraron problemas críticos


Fecha del diagnóstico: 2026-07-04 23:48:12

← Volver al inicio